There are two answers to this.
1) The lines could be parallel if their y intercepts are different.
2) The lines are different forms of the same line.
For example
parallel:
- y = 3x + 5
- y = 3x - 2
Different forms of the same line.
- y = 4x + 2
- 2y = 8x +4
The second condition is termed consistent. The second condition is of 2 lines with the same slope and the same y intercept.
